Hepatotoxicity Avoidance

Meaning

Hepatotoxicity Avoidance is a clinical and pharmaceutical design imperative focused on implementing strategies to prevent or minimize damage to the liver caused by therapeutic agents, particularly in the context of long-term hormonal or metabolic therapies. This involves careful selection of drug analogues, optimization of the delivery route to bypass initial hepatic exposure, and rigorous monitoring of liver function biomarkers. For the patient receiving hormonal support, this proactive approach is paramount for maintaining hepatic health and overall longevity. This clinical focus ensures the long-term safety of necessary pharmacological interventions.
